Output 3a5e85497a756a260faa05b2c27de18b49cc32e6a2648d1e9237e930d6dee689:0

value
10670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c77c07b7cb34094d13c509e9f1c5ffb05f0e08a OP_EQUAL
address
35k97VSF6vUZneRdtmGvbwbypUUDejDjSs
transaction
3a5e85497a756a260faa05b2c27de18b49cc32e6a2648d1e9237e930d6dee689
confirmations
187791
spent
true